1. Best Bundled Golf Community, Copperleaf at The Brooks

If bundled golf is high on your list, Copperleaf at The Brooks deserves serious consideration.

Located on the Bonita Springs and Estero border, just around the corner from Coconut Point, Copperleaf offers an excellent combination of golf, lifestyle, and location.

A bundled golf community means that every household has a golf membership attached to the property. The costs are shared across the community, and residents have access to golf as part of the ownership structure. Not everyone plays golf, but everyone has the ability to.

What makes Copperleaf especially attractive is its lower density. With only about 570 residences, the community does not feel oversaturated. For golfers who want the ability to play often, that matters.

Copperleaf features an 18 hole Gordon Lewis designed golf course, a recently updated clubhouse, dining, a pro shop, fitness center, tennis, bocce, and a beautiful outdoor dining and bar area near the pool.

Another major benefit is that Copperleaf is part of The Brooks, which gives residents the option to join The Commons Club. Depending on the membership selected, that can include additional dining, fitness, pickleball, and even access to a private beach club on the Gulf of Mexico.

Home options include carriage homes and single family homes, with a variety of sizes and layouts. The location is also a major win, close to Coconut Point, I 75, RSW airport, restaurants, shopping, and beaches.

Best fit: Golfers who want a true bundled golf experience, a convenient location, and a smaller community feel.

2. Best 55 Plus Community, Valencia Bonita

For active 55 plus living in Southwest Florida, Valencia Bonita in Bonita Springs continues to stand out.

Developed by GL Homes, Valencia Bonita brought the popular Valencia lifestyle concept to Southwest Florida, and it has been a major success. The community sits on approximately 347 acres and includes just under 1,000 residences, including villas and single family homes.

The heart of Valencia Bonita is the clubhouse and lifestyle program.

Residents enjoy a grand ballroom with a stage, live entertainment, Broadway style shows, a full service spa, culinary studio, art studio, card rooms, billiards, indoor and outdoor dining, and a packed social calendar.

The pool area includes multiple pools, including a lap pool, resort style pool, resistance pool, and spa. The community also offers tennis, pickleball, walking and biking trails, a dog park, fitness programs, clubs, theme parties, wine groups, poker nights, Bible studies, and so much more.

One of the biggest reasons people love Valencia Bonita is the full time lifestyle director. This is not a community where the amenities simply exist, they are actively programmed and used.

Valencia Bonita is a strong fit for buyers who want connection, activity, and a community that makes it easy to meet people and stay engaged.

Best fit: Active adults looking for 55 plus living, strong social programming, resort amenities, and a full lifestyle experience.

3. Best Resort Style Amenities, Verdana Village

If you are looking for a newer gated community with major resort style amenities, Verdana Village in Estero is one of the most talked about communities in Southwest Florida.

Located east on Corkscrew Road, Verdana Village is a master planned community by Cameratta Companies. When complete, it is expected to include approximately 2,400 residences.

The amenity center is what truly sets Verdana Village apart.

One of the most unique features is the indoor sports complex with air conditioned pickleball, basketball, and volleyball. In the middle of a Southwest Florida summer, that is a very big deal.

Outside, residents enjoy a resort style pool and spa, outdoor tennis, outdoor pickleball, a pro shop, fitness center, classes, dog park, and multiple dining options. There is indoor and outdoor dining by the pool, a craft beer lounge, and a cafe.

Another major convenience is The Shops at Verdana Village, located right outside the gates. Anchored by Publix, the commercial area includes restaurants, services, and everyday conveniences. It is common to see residents using their golf carts to grab groceries, coffee, dinner, or errands.

Verdana Village has a wide appeal. It works for families, retirees, young professionals, seasonal residents, and multigenerational households. The energy is active, social, and welcoming.

Home options include mostly single family homes, along with some villas, with a wide range of floor plans and sizes.

Best fit: Buyers who want newer construction, resort style amenities, sports, dining, convenience, and a lively community atmosphere.

4. Best Luxury Community, Miromar Lakes Beach and Golf Club

When it comes to luxury living in Southwest Florida, Miromar Lakes Beach and Golf Club is in a class of its own.

Located in Estero, Miromar Lakes is known for its private lakefront lifestyle, white sand beach, boating, resort style amenities, and luxury service.

At the center of the community is Lake Como, a 700 acre freshwater lake where residents can boat, water ski, kayak, paddleboard, and enjoy the water right from the community. Waterfront homes may allow docks, depending on the property and location within the community.

Miromar Lakes also features approximately three miles of private white sand beach, which creates a beach lifestyle inside a gated residential community.

The Beach Club is another major highlight. Residents enjoy indoor and outdoor dining, poolside dining, live music, social events, a spa and salon, fitness center, botanical garden, tennis, pickleball, bocce, marina access, and concierge services.

The concierge service is one of the details that separates Miromar Lakes from many other communities. Residents can request help with things like reservations, home services, refrigerator stocking, housekeeping coordination, and other lifestyle needs.

Golf is also available through optional membership, with an Arthur Hills signature championship course.

Miromar Lakes offers a wide range of property types, including condos, villas, carriage homes, single family homes, and luxury waterfront estates.

Best fit: Luxury buyers looking for a high service, resort inspired lifestyle with boating, beach, dining, social events, and optional golf.

5. Best Included Beach Club, Pelican Landing

For buyers who want private beach access included as part of the community lifestyle, Pelican Landing in Bonita Springs is hard to beat.

One of the most unique features of Pelican Landing is its private beach club on Big Hickory Island. Residents take a boat shuttle from the community marina to the beach, where chairs and facilities are available.

It is a special experience, and one of the reasons Pelican Landing has remained so popular for decades.

But the beach club is only one part of the lifestyle. Pelican Landing also offers a strong amenities package, including tennis, pickleball, bocce, fitness, a canoe and kayak park on Spring Creek, fishing, a butterfly garden, sailing opportunities, and access to the marina.

Golf is also available through optional membership at The Nest Golf Club, which features two Tom Fazio designed courses.

Pelican Landing is a more established community, originally started in the 1980s. It has mature landscaping, beautiful trees, and a peaceful nature preserve feel. With more than 3,300 residences, it also offers a wide variety of housing options, including condos, coach homes, villas, single family homes, and estate properties.

Its location is another major advantage, near Coconut Point, US 41, dining, shopping, beaches, and everyday conveniences.

Best fit: Buyers looking for an established community with included private beach club access, nature, amenities, and a wide variety of home options.
